LX06 YBN is a 2006 Mitsubishi Outlander in Black with a 2,378c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.

Across all 2006 Mitsubishi Outlander models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.7% with a typical mileage of 65,242 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Mitsubishi Outlander f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 4,278 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LX06 YBN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mitsubishi Outlander typ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 20 years old, this Mitsubishi Outlander is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
